The Xbox Social Privacy Settings allow parents to control their children’s online interactions within the Xbox ecosystem. Tabletop roleplaying games like Dungeons & Dragons offer immersive storytelling experiences. Players collaborate to create narratives, solve challenges, and develop characters. YouTube Gaming provides a platform for live streaming and watching gaming content. It’s notable for its large community, interactive features like chat, and focus on mobile viewing. Decentraland is a persistent, user-generated metaverse built on the Polygon blockchain. It offers a digital world accessible through VR headsets or desktop computers where individuals can develop games, display art, build social spaces and earn cryptocurrency by participating in its economy.
